Michael
Lee Dowell, “Uncle Mike,” 61, of New River, Ariz., peacefully
passed away on Aug.15, from a motorcycle accident. He served
in the U.S. Navy for two years and then served in the Reserves.
He was a union cement mason for 40 years in Local 394 and
he served for five years as a Fire Fighter Reservist for
the Daisy Mountain Fire Department. He was an active member
of “Riders of Fire” motorcycle club for six months.
He
is preceded in death by his father, Lee Dowell.
Mike
is survived by his wife of 27 years, Susan; mother, Janet;
sister, Sharron, and her husband, Dennis Rachke; two daughters,
Kimberly and Jessica; and five grandchildren, Joshua, Austin,
Shaynna, Dexter and Zachary. In addition, he is survived
by many nieces and nephews, and hundreds of other family
members and friends.
